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al strips or barriers that are integrated into a roof’s design. These flashing components are typically placed around roof penetrations such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and along roof valleys or edges. The primary purpose of roof flashing is to create a watertight seal that prevents water from seeping into the underlying roof structure. Properly installed flashing helps maintain the integrity of the roof by directing water away from vulnerable areas, thereby reducing the risk of leaks and water damage.

One common issue addressed by roof flashing services is water infiltration caused by damaged or improperly installed flashing. Over time, flashing can corrode, crack, or become displaced due to weather exposure, wind, or aging materials. When flashing fails, it can lead to leaks that damage roofs, ceilings, walls, and even the building’s interior. Repair or replacement of faulty flashing helps prevent these issues, safeguarding the property’s structural integrity and avoiding costly repairs associated with water intrusion.

Properties that frequently utilize roof flashing services include resid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Residential properties often require flashing around chimneys, skylights, and roof valleys to prevent leaks. Commercial buildings, especially those with flat or low-slope roofs, depend heavily on properly installed flashing to ensure water does not penetrate the roofing system. Multi-unit dwellings and historic properties may also need specialized flashing services to address unique architectural features and older construction materials, ensuring continued protection against water damage.

Cost Range for Roof Flashing Installation - The typical cost for installing roof flashing can vary from approximately $300 to $1,200,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ive work on larger roofs can approach the higher end.

Average Material Costs - Materials for roof flashing, such as aluminum or copper, generally range from $10 to $25 per linear foot. The total material expense depends on the length of flashing needed for a specific roof surface.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for roof flashing services us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The overall labor charge depends on the project's scope, complexity, and local labor rates.

Additional Factors Influencing Cost - Factors like roof pitch, accessibility, and the extent of damage can influence the final price, with some projects costing more due to difficult-to-reach areas or extensive repairs. What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ed at joints and edges to prevent water infiltration and protect the roof structure.

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ps prevent leaks and water damage by directing water away from vulnerable areas of the roof.

How do I know if my roof flashing needs repair or replacement? Signs include water stains, rust, or damaged, cracked, or missing flashing components observed during inspections.

What materials are commonly used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with roofing materials.
